学完c语言后可以干什么?

Python06

学完c语言后可以干什么?,第1张

学完c语言后可以干什么?

当开发工程师

学完C语言干什么好

看看其他的书,多程式设计序

对于初学者学完C语言可以干什么

一般来说初学者学完C语言仅仅是学习了最基础的语法部分,所以其实并不能做些很高大上的东西。(当然字元版本的贪吃蛇,扫雷这些比较基础的应该还是能做出来的)

在学习完C语言语法后就应该要考虑一下自己要往哪一个方向发展,是要做嵌入式程式还是做应用程式或是系统程式。然后依照自己所定的方向进行进一步的学习。

举个例子,如果要学习应用程式,那么就应该去找《Windows程式设计》这样的书进行学习,里面会有一些全新的函式库,学习好这些函式库你才能在Windows平台下做出一个令人满意的应用程式。

c语言可以干什么

可以回答你说的话

学了C语言可以干什么

因为 C 语言只不过是一个具体的程式设计工具而已(就像平时的 C++、C#、JAVA、Python语言等),所以如果只是精通掌握了 C 语言的程式设计,而没有掌握资料结构和计算机演算法的知识,那么只能够做一些简单的程式设计工作。如果将来打算真正做大软体的开发工作,那么像:资料结构、计算机演算法(例如:各种排序、以及查询演算法等)、演算法复杂性分析、各种数学模型(例如:高等数学、概率统计等)都是必须要熟练掌握的。当然了,如果 C 语言程式设计已经掌握得非常熟练了,即使再学习另外的语言程式设计,和学习这些困难的理论知识相比起来,那还是容易得多了。

学了c语言可以干什么

C语言作为使用最广的程式语言,没有之一,可以做很多方面的开发,比如最多的嵌入式开发,像我们超市用的POS机,街头上的LED显示板。一些伺服器,也是用C语言开发的(底层)。各种硬体驱动,也几乎都有用到。当然,如果有你去了解我们的作业系统,也是用C语言开发的。其实学习和使用某种语言,在懂语法之后,更重要的是对库的了解和使用,如你现在用的stdio.h string.h stdlib.h ....你可以从事一些嵌入式行业的底层驱动和应用的开发,这种工作是最多用到C的。如果想在手机和PC上开发,现在得学一些高阶语言,如果 java,MFC,c#,c++。学JAVA不一定说是要学C之后去学,虽然JAVA是用C开发的。现在主流的语言,很大部份是C系列的,你只要学会了一种,就比较容易上手另一种。你说的系统性程式设计,太范了,做一般的开发,就主要是有效的组织系统提供的语法与介面,如你现在用的,int a=b+c,printf,然后去实现某种功能。如老师布置的作业,在DOS介面列印一个矩形。当然,开发一个产品要比这复杂的多得多。

c语言可以干什么,c++呢?

简单说,软体开发可以简单分为几层层:直接操作硬体(驱动层)→作业系统→应用软体。 驱动层:操作硬体,比如说,开启LED灯,点亮萤幕等;一般用汇编语言、C语言编写; 作业系统:我们用的比较多的windows系统、Linux系统、安卓系统、Unix系统等

二级C语言学完以后想要往深学该干什么

往深了学的话,你可以学Windows程式设计,是编软体用的。C++、Java等(和C语言并列的语言)面向物件的语言可以学,应该是挺简单了,因为你已经学了C语言了。

学习Java语言后可以干什么

学Java语言,以后就是从事Java开发的工作,Java开发现在就业好,薪资也挺高的。

二级C语言证书可以干什么

刚毕业找工作有的单位要。或者,你的学校要求有证,不然不让毕业。其他就没什么用了。

1、对于程序员来说,数据结构和算法是必修课程,学过的和没学过的写出来的代码可以说有天渊之别,你必须让你的代码具有艺术性!!(至少你得懂得如何让你的代码省时间,省空间)\x0d\x0a2、Linux编程的好处不仅是开源,还是跨平台的,不管你怎样的拉进来都跑得动,windows就不行了。顺便一说,以后的公司企业上基本都是基于Linux平台上的开发的,正如所说的好处,开源跨平台,谁都能用而且好用,而windows的话,你用得交钱,你说企业会用哪个?\x0d\x0a3、如果你确定学Linux编程,就把C深啃下去,继续研究,要是想学Windows编程,可以先学C++,再学MFC或者.NET\x0d\x0a4、当然了,兴趣的最主要的,只要你有兴趣就能坚持下去,IT这样是个无底洞,没有学得完的一天,贵在坚持。

呵呵,c语言知识只是入门哦。

首先推荐你精进理论知识,数据结构和算法,不说精通,但绝对要了解。

其次,根据你的兴趣和爱好,选择方向。

c/c++主要针对底层系统,以及对速度和性能要求较高的软件,比如3d绘图,数据库,操作系统,网络服务端等等。

JAVA针对手机平台,以及网络方面的应用开发。

python,php,javascript等脚本语言适合web开发。

也可以做DBA,学数据库。

总之有很多种,你自己上网去查,这里就不累述了。

当然,掌握一门甚至多门语言,不代表就万事ok了。比如你用c++开发图形图像类软件,那么你必需对图形图像的相关理论知识有所了解,又如用java开发网络类程序,你必须对计算机网络,Tcp/ip协议有所了解,要开发文件系统,就必须对操作系统的有所了解。

如果需要参加实际的项目,那么你还要学一些框架类的知识,比如.NET框架,J2EE框架,MFC框架等等,从事图形学,你得学习OPENGL,DirectX等等。只有掌握了相关框架的API这样才能够构架大的系统。

总之呢,给你的建议就是:数据结构+算法+你感兴趣的方向

其中,你感兴趣的方向=相关理论知识+具体的实践语言+对应的框架API